Google Maps is updated with exciting new features

New features for an optimal experience

Google Maps has taken a step forward in its evolution, offering an even more complete and effective user experience. The maps and navigation app par excellence has introduced five new features that will undoubtedly change the way we interact with the environment.

These innovations not only increase the usefulness of the app, but also demonstrate Google Maps’ continued commitment to innovation. Millions of users will benefit from these improvements daily.

Immersive 3D exploration

One of the most notable additions is the immersive 3D view. This feature allows users to explore cities and tourist spots in a three-dimensional way, improving the visual experience and navigation. You will be able to appreciate architectural details and landscapes in a more realistic and immersive way.

Live directions

Another update is the live view. This feature superimposes real-time directions on the image captured by your camera, making it easier to find your way even in places with insufficient signage. Simply enter your destination, select ‘Directions’ and activate live view to start receiving directions.

Integration with Google Lens

Now, Google Maps also incorporates Google Lens, giving you instant information about your surroundings through the camera. With this feature, you will be able to identify monuments, buildings and other points of interest, as well as learn details about hours, history and reviews.

Iniciativa Project Green Light

Google Maps’ Green Light project aims to improve traffic efficiency. It analyses traffic patterns in real time and adjusts traffic lights to reduce congestion, making it especially useful in large cities.

Conversational search

Finally, Google Maps introduces conversational search, a function based on artificial intelligence that allows you to interact with the app naturally. You will be able to ask questions and receive detailed answers, making it easier to plan your trips and providing valuable information.
